任意写一个三位数(个位上的数字不为零),把这个三位数的百位上的数字与个位上的数字对调后得到一个新的三位数(三位数的十位上

任意写一个三位数(个位上的数字不为零),把这个三位数的百位上的数字与个位上的数字对调后得到一个新的三位数(三位数的十位上的数字保持不变),如果把这两个三位数中的较大的三位数减去较小的三位数,那么请你猜猜这两个三位数之差一定是哪几个数的倍数(1的倍数除外)?说说你的理由.
mhr1982926 1年前 已收到2个回答 举报

hmm07 幼苗

共回答了18个问题采纳率:88.9% 举报

假设这个三位数的百位、十位和个位数分别是a、b、c,则这个数等于 100a+10b+c
百位和个位对调后,得到的三位数等于100c+10b+a
把这两个三位数中的较大的三位数减去较小的三位数,
也就是|100a+10b+c-(100c+10b+a)|=|99a-99c|=99x|a-c|,所以是99的倍数

1年前

2

azurecat 幼苗

共回答了1个问题 举报

设这个三位数百位上是 X,十位上是Y, 个位上是Z(Z不为0),则该三位数是A=100X+10Y+Z,个位与百位对调后得B=100Z+10Y+X
若X>Z,则A>B,
所以A-B=100X+10Y+Z-(100Z+10Y+X)=99(X-Z),
因为X>Z,所以(X-Z)是整数,因此凡是99的公约数一定是(A-B)的公约数,即3,9,11,33,99。因此这两个三位数之差一...

1年前

1
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 17 q. 0.023 s. - webmaster@yulucn.com